The Love Story: How Selena and Benny Got Here

Selena Gomez and Benny Blanco’s connection predates their romantic relationship by nearly a decade. Blanco, whose real name is Benjamin Joseph Levin, co-produced several tracks on Gomez’s 2015 album Revival and continued to collaborate with her on subsequent projects. Their professional relationship was rooted in mutual creative respect, and both have spoken about how their friendship deepened over years of working together before romantic feelings developed.

Gomez confirmed the relationship in December 2023 with a characteristically straightforward Instagram post that set the internet ablaze. In the months that followed, the couple became known for their refreshingly low-key public presence — cooking together on social media, attending friends’ events as a pair, and generally behaving like two people who genuinely enjoy each other’s company rather than performing for an audience.

The engagement came in November 2025, with Gomez sharing a photo of a stunning oval-cut diamond ring that jewelry experts estimated at between $300,000 and $500,000. The announcement was met with an outpouring of affection from fans who have watched Gomez navigate very public — and sometimes very painful — relationships in the spotlight.

The Ring: A Closer Look at Selena’s Engagement Sparkle

Selena’s engagement ring has become a topic of fascination in its own right. The ring features an oval-cut diamond, estimated at approximately 6 to 8 carats, set on a delicate pavé band. Jewelers have noted that the setting is classic and timeless — a choice that aligns with Gomez’s personal style, which has always favored elegance over ostentation.

Multiple jewelry experts consulted by ELLE have praised the ring’s proportions and cut quality, calling it “a perfect reflection of their relationship: understated but undeniably beautiful.” The oval cut has seen a surge in popularity in recent years, favored by celebrity brides including Hailey Bieber, Blake Lively, and Kourtney Kardashian.

Blanco reportedly worked with a private jeweler to custom-design the ring, a process that took several months. Sources close to the couple have said that Gomez was genuinely surprised by the proposal, which took place during a private dinner at their Los Angeles home — no elaborate public spectacle, just an intimate moment between two people ready to commit to a life together.

Wedding Planning: What We Know So Far

While the couple has been understandably protective of their wedding planning details, several credible reports have painted a picture of what to expect.

The Date: Multiple sources indicate a late spring or early summer 2026 ceremony, though the exact date has not been publicly confirmed. Given both Gomez’s and Blanco’s professional schedules — she has been filming and promoting new projects, he continues to produce for A-list artists — a summer date would align with a natural break in their work commitments.

The Venue: Reports have varied, with some outlets suggesting a Malibu estate, others pointing to a Montecito location, and still others hinting at a possible destination wedding in Italy. What seems consistent across reports is the couple’s desire for an intimate setting rather than a massive spectacle — a guest list in the range of 150 to 200 people rather than the 500-plus extravaganzas that some celebrity weddings become.

The Aesthetic: Sources close to Gomez have described the wedding vision as “romantic, warm, and deeply personal.” Expect soft florals, candlelight, and a color palette that leans toward warm neutrals and blush tones rather than anything overly trendy. The couple is reportedly working with Mindy Weiss, the celebrity event planner behind weddings for Sofia Vergara, Jessica Simpson, and other A-listers.

The Dress: This is the question that has fashion observers most eager. Gomez has long been associated with several major fashion houses and has worn designs by Valentino, Versace, and Oscar de la Renta on major red carpets. Bridal speculation has centered on a few likely candidates, with Valentino and custom Vera Wang emerging as early frontrunners in the fashion press.

The couple reportedly wants their wedding to feel like “a big family dinner with dancing” — intimate, joyful, and authentically them.

Who is Benny Blanco?

Benny Blanco (born Benjamin Joseph Levin) is a Grammy-nominated music producer, songwriter, and artist. He has produced hits for artists including Ed Sheeran, Rihanna, Justin Bieber, Katy Perry, and Selena Gomez. He is also known for his cooking content on social media and his own music releases.
